Set Up Push Notifications
Configure push notifications to send subscription alerts directly to external applications using webhooks.
Who configures push notifications: Team members who use external collaboration tools can configure webhooks to receive subscription alerts in those applications.
Prerequisites: You must have active subscriptions.
Configure Push Notifications
To set up push notifications:
- Click on your avatar on the header and select My Details.
- Select Push Notifications.
- Click on the application icon.
- Enter a name for the push notification.
- Paste in the Webhook URL from your external application.
- Click Add.
Your push notifications are now configured. You will receive alerts in the connected application for all your active subscriptions.
Troubleshooting
Webhook not receiving notifications
Verify the webhook URL is correct and the external application is configured to accept incoming webhooks. Test the webhook using the external application's testing tools to ensure it's active. Also confirm you have active subscriptions in Digital.ai Agility—without subscriptions, no notifications will be sent.
Push notifications stopped working
Webhook URLs can expire or be revoked by the external application. Check the external application to verify the webhook is still active. If the webhook expired, generate a new webhook URL and update it in Digital.ai Agility.
Not all notifications are being pushed
Some external applications have rate limits or filtering rules that block certain notifications. Review the external application's webhook settings and logs to identify any blocked or filtered messages. If notifications are too frequent, consider refining your subscription filters in Digital.ai Agility.
Can't add webhook URL—Add button disabled
Ensure you've entered both a name and a valid webhook URL in the form. Webhook URLs typically start with https:// and must be complete, including any required authentication tokens or parameters provided by the external application.
